"Nevada's Groundbreaking State-Regulated Cannabis Lounge: A Closer Look at 'Smoke and Mirrors'"

Chris LaPorte, former owner of Insert Coins bar, plans to open "Smoke and Mirrors," a state-regulated cannabis lounge in Las Vegas. The 1,200-square-foot venue, expected to open in October, aims to provide an elevated experience for cannabis consumers with plush seating, a DJ stage, and a special access smoking room. The lounge, pending final inspections, will offer a reservation system to tailor the cannabis journey for guests, including cannabis mixology and infused accouterments. LaPorte aims to create a laid-back, inclusive space that goes beyond traditional nightlife spots on the Strip.

Nevada grants licenses for first cannabis consumption lounges.

Nevada regulators have approved the first three cannabis consumption lounges, including two in the Las Vegas Valley, paving the way for some of the state’s first public spaces that allow marijuana use. The licensees must receive approval through their local jurisdictions and undergo a final inspection before opening. The Cannabis Compliance Board also adjusted its air quality regulations for consumption lounges during the Tuesday meeting.
